About the project
The UI Development Kit is a template for building desktop applications integrating with Identity Security Cloud.
SvelteKit
SvelteKit is a framework that allows easy application development, utilizing both front-end and back-end components, as well as modern security standards. When you're ready to build the UI development kit, it allows you to compile your code into numerous different deployment methods by using different adapters (static html, node server, edge, or lambda functions).
SvelteKit can be explored more here.
If you use this starter to build on top of an existing project, you will get several things implemented right out of the box:
- OAuth Flow
- SailPoint SDK
- Desktop build of your application
- TypeScript
- SvelteKit
- TailwindCSS
Electron
Electron is a framework that allows you to build cross-platform desktop applications, using web technologies. It combines the Chromium rendering engine and the Node.js runtime to allow you to build applications that can run on Windows, Mac, and Linux.
In the projects src folder, there are two additional folders: main and preload. These folders contain the code relevant to the electron portion of the application. The electron portion of the application is where you determine the window theme, size, shape, and behavior as well as the startup logic for the application.
Use the starter
To use this starter application, you must install NPM. You can find instructions about how to install NPM here.
Once you have NPM installed, you can clone this repository and run the following commands, depending on your package manager of choice.
Install dependencies
To install the dependencies, run install using your package manager of choice:
# NPM
npm install
# Yarn
yarn install
# PNPM
pnpm install
Local Development
To start the application in development mode, first install dependencies. Then run the dev script using your package manager of choice:
# NPM
npm run dev
# Yarn
yarn dev
# PNPM
pnpm dev
Build the application from source
To build the application from source, first install dependencies. Then run the build script matching your OS platform, using your package manager of choice:
| Command | Description | OS |
|---|---|---|
build:win |
Builds the application for Windows. | Windows |
build:mac |
Builds the application for MacOS. | MacOS |
build:linux |
Builds the application for Linux. | Linux |
# NPM
npm run build:win
# Yarn
yarn build:mac
# PNPM
pnpm build:linux
